Understanding Weather Alert Reliability: A Comprehensive Guide

Weather alerts are vital tools that inform the public about impending hazardous weather conditions, enabling timely protective actions. In the United States, these alerts are primarily issued by the National Weather Service (NWS), a division of the National Oceanic and Atmospheric Administration (NOAA). The NWS employs a structured system to disseminate warnings, watches, and advisories, each serving a distinct purpose:

  • Watch: Indicates that conditions are favorable for a hazardous event to occur.
  • Warning: Signifies that a hazardous event is imminent or already occurring.
  • Advisory: Alerts to less severe but still significant weather conditions.

These alerts are disseminated through various channels, including the Emergency Alert System (EAS), Wireless Emergency Alerts (WEA), NOAA Weather Radio, and the Integrated Public Alert & Warning System (IPAWS). Each channel has its strengths, ensuring that critical information reaches the public promptly. (weather.gov)

Assessing the Reliability of Weather Alerts

The reliability of weather alerts hinges on the accuracy of the data, the timeliness of dissemination, and the effectiveness of the communication channels. The NWS continually refines its forecasting models and warning systems to enhance these aspects. For instance, the Warn-on-Forecast project aims to improve the lead time and precision of severe weather warnings, thereby increasing their reliability. (nssl.noaa.gov)
